Varnhill Logistics accounted for 46% of trailing twelve-month revenue, up from 38% the prior year, driven largely by expanded orders for the Corvane fitting line. Should Varnhill reduce volumes or renegotiate terms, margin exposure would be immediate and material. Diversification efforts in the Teldmoor region remain early-stage. We recommend close monitoring over the next two quarters. The steps under consideration are outlined in the note below.

board note of bawep-tajef: Queniusek Systems plans to raise the Quenvan list price by 53.1 percent in March. The pricing group signed off on a budget of $176.4 million for Project Drueth. The renewal with Casionix Partners closes at $142.5 million a year, 8.3 percent below the last contract. Project Fraax slips by six weeks because of the tooling delay.

Re: Retirement of the Stonebriar product line

Stonebriar sales have declined for five consecutive quarters and support costs now exceed contribution margin. The retirement plan is staged: new orders close end of Q2, existing contracts honoured through their terms, and spares stocked for twenty-four months. Sales leads should steer prospects toward the Ashgrove range; migration incentives are already approved. Customer comms are drafted and awaiting legal sign-off. The forward strategy behind this decision is set out in the note below.

confidential, yafog-hagug: Gross margin on Druix came in at 10 percent against a plan of 15 percent. Only 5 of the 80 pilot accounts renewed Druix, so a churn review is set for October 1.

The Ledgervale reporting service partitions its transaction tables by calendar month across all three environments. Staging keeps six partitions, production keeps twenty-four, and old partitions roll off automatically on the first Sunday of each month. Support should never drop partitions manually. Each environment's partition scheduler runs with its own settings, and the current production values appear in the block below.

deployment values, yadug-bawif:
[framir]
team = pelox
access_code = ac_a38ab2
owner = tamion.julael
host = framir.tolvaqlabs.test
port = 11211
peer = tammir.zemvargrid.local
salt = 2215ef03
pin = 1541